Can we display the Highlighted topic at the top of the New Topic page?
I've noticed that a lot of people start new topics to report a problem or to ask a question that happens to already be the subject of a Highlighted topic.
For example, the "Twitter IM is down" topic has been the highlighted topic for Twitter since May 23. And yet new users keep creating new topics asking about this very same thing.
After two weeks of this, I'm beginning to conclude that it's the general tendency of new GSFN users to immediately start a topic right away, without looking around first.
So I was wondering -- is it possible to display the Highlighted topic at the top of the New Topic page, so people who go straight into creating a new topic have a chance to see it?
